The Heroku free tier is [going away on November 28](https://techcrunch.com/2022/08/25/heroku-announces-plans-to-eliminate-free-plans-blaming-fraud-and-abuse/), so I'd like to find another way to host dashboards created with Plotly and Dash for free (or for a low cost). I'm trying out Google's Cloud Run service since it offers a free tier, but I'd love to hear what other services people have used to host Plotly and Dash. For instance, has anyone tried hosting Plotly/Dash on Firebase or Render?
